It has been reported that Freddie Prinze Jr. hasn’t yet been offered a role in an upcoming sequel to his 1997 breakout hit, I Know What You Did Last Summer, although it had already been published in the trades that he would be starring in it. Ironically, that original film was so miserable for the actor that he almost left the movie business altogether. According to Deadline, Prinze Jr. had clashed with the director of that film to the point of almost quitting mid-production.
While promoting his new podcast, That Was Pretty Scary, in an interview, Prinze Jr. opened up about the difficult time he was having with director Jim Gillespie on his first major Hollywood movie. “There was no passive aggressiveness — which I hate — (the director) was very direct in the fact that, ‘I don’t want you in this movie,’ So when that’s your first job and you hear those words,...
